GreatSchools Rating
The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.

Gustine High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Gustine, CA, in the Gustine neighborhood, and is served by the Gustine Unified School District in California. Annual tuition is $0. The school has a total enrollment of 531 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 20:1. Academic records show that 10%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 48% are proficient in reading. Gustine High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of C and a GreatSchools Rating of 5 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.5, the graduation rate is 95%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1010 and an ACT score of 22. The average home value in this area is $407,691.
